Royalton is an unincorporated community in Eagle Township, Boone County, Indiana.

History

A post office was established at Royalton (but was called Rodmans until 1838[3]) in 1832, and remained in operation until it was discontinued in 1903.[4]

Geography and Location

Royalton is located at 39°55′37″N 86°20′18″W / 39.92694°N 86.33833°W / 39.92694; -86.33833. Royalton is located along Indianapolis Rd approximately 0.7 miles northwest of Marion County. The town is made up of three main streets - Royal Avenue, Circle Drive, and Harmon Avenue.
